Urgent!!need Help, Removing Trunk Keyhole

i slid that little tab that held it in place....it came off, so now i have a keyhole thats just sliding back and forth, help me out please, id like to get this done before night....ive been trying to figure this out for the past 40 minutes, its ruining my install time here.....

You disconnected the rod that goes to the latch? And the tab is completely off? If I remember correctly it should just pull right out. It may need to be rotated.

Yeah, I just looked it up in my haynes manual and you have to rotate it 45deg.
